    What does a mirror do to light?
    The metals inside mirrors perform the same trick, reflecting all the colours of the visible spectrum, but the difference is they're ultra-smooth on a microscopic level. A piece of paper might seem smooth to you, but it's not even in the same smoothness league as a mirror, and that's how a mirror image is formed: all of the light is bouncing straight back in the direction it's just come from.

    What is the symbolic meaning of a mirror?
    Mirrors project reflections of images and the world by reflecting light. As such, the symbolism of mirrors is greatly entwined with the symbolism of light. Below are symbolic meanings of mirrors. Truth – As an object that gives us the real reflection of subjects, objects, and the environment, mirrors are an obvious representation of truth. A mirror will not lie to make you feel better.
